    Flagstaff can get as much as four feet of snow. My wife and I drove out to Flagstaff in 1997. We kept noticing huge piles of snow on large vacant lots. Finally we got into a conversation with a Navajo man that worked in Flagstaff. He said a snow front came in and circled the mountain there. It dumped snow for 17 straight hours. When it was over people had to drop out of windows. They took almost a week for the town to open up completely. It can snow insane amounts out there occasionally.
